Industry experts and policymakers have highlighted the importance of digitalized value chains, fair pricing, and interest rate adjustments as key measures to stabilize the prices of essential commodities. These discussions took place at a policy conclave titled ‘Fair Prices of Food Commodities: Exploring Strategies for Market Supervision’, organized by Bonik Barta.
During the event, Dr. Khandaker Golam Moazzem, Research Director at the Center for Policy Dialogue (CPD), emphasized the need for a digitized and integrated food supply chain in Bangladesh to enhance efficiency, transparency, and accessibility. He noted that a lack of comprehensive data limits the effectiveness of market oversight.
Speakers pointed to multiple pricing layers in food procurement, particularly in the rice supply chain, as a key challenge. Discussions also addressed concerns about market concentration, tax policies, and supply chain inefficiencies affecting commodity pricing. Experts suggested sector-specific tax approaches and improved VAT implementation to create a more balanced economic environment.
Banking and financial sector concerns were also raised, with participants citing high non-performing loans and liquidity challenges as hurdles to economic stability. Calls were made for enhanced transparency in loan utilization and policy adjustments to support businesses.
The event also examined the role of digitalization in supply chain management, with comparisons drawn to regional markets that have made progress in formalizing trade through technology-driven solutions. Experts advocated for long-term strategies to integrate digital systems into market supervision.
Stakeholders emphasized the need for policy implementation to encourage market competition, support producers, and ensure stable consumer prices. Discussions concluded with calls for greater oversight, regulatory improvements, and data-driven approaches to strengthen market resilience.
